Harrison kept a clean sheet against Sierra on Tuesday. Everything went their way against the Sierra Stallions as they made off with a 7-0 victory. The Panthers haven't had any issues with the Stallions recently, as the game was their seventh consecutive win against them.
Harrison's offense was hitting Sierra from everywhere, as five different players booted in a goal. Lexy Wilson led that balanced group of strikers and accounted for two goals all by herself.
Harrison now has a winning record of 2-1. As for Sierra,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 0-3.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Harrison will face off against Pueblo Centennial at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Sierra, they will square off against Pueblo East at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day.
